An Air National Guard fiber cable installation team is implementing the 'Fiber Deep' project on Joint Base Pearl Harbor-Hickam, Hawaii. This project aims to save up to $60 million by reducing upkeep and repair costs while also upgrading the base against cyber threats. The Air Force is pushing transition from copper to fiber; therefore, copper will only be installed when optical fiber cannot support the requirement. New copper premise wiring will be IAW UFC 3-580-01
